Foodborne Outbreak Prevention and Response

The information on these pages is provided to assist managers and owners in preventing and responding to illness outbreak.  In the event of an foodborne outbreak, the Health District will collaborate with your business to identify appropriate corrective actions and recommend precautions to end the foodborne outbreak as quick as possible.

In the event of an outbreak, the Southern Nevada Health District will work with your business to identify appropriate corrective actions and precautions to end the outbreak quickly.

If you suspect that you might be experiencing an outbreak at your property, please reach out to the Health District immediately. The sooner we know about it, the sooner we can work together to help end it. You can call the Office of Epidemiology at (702) 759-1300 at any time, Environmental Health Foodborne Illness at (702) 759-1504, or your assigned inspector during business hours.
